Cost Factors Affecting Lactation Pod Pricing

When it comes to determining the cost of a lactation pod, various factors come into play:

Technology and Features: Advanced technological features like smart locks, ventilation systems, and privacy sensors can elevate the price of a lactation pod.

Size and Design Options: Larger pods with intricate designs may cost more due to the materials used and customization required.

Customization and Additional Amenities: Adding amenities such as charging outlets, reclining chairs, or sound systems can increase the overall price.

Maintenance and Upkeep Costs: Factoring in maintenance expenses and long-term upkeep can impact the initial cost of the pod.

Installation Expenses: Installation complexity, location, and additional services needed during setup contribute to the total cost.

Saving Money on Lactation Pod Purchase

There are strategies to help save on the purchase of a lactation pod:

Negotiating with Suppliers: Engaging in negotiations with suppliers can lead to cost savings and potential discounts.

Bulk Ordering Discounts: Ordering multiple units can often result in discounted rates per pod.

Leasing or Renting Options: Exploring leasing or rental options can provide flexibility and reduced initial investment.

Government Funding and Support Programs: Many government initiatives support the installation of lactation pods, offering financial assistance to encourage their implementation in public spaces.
